Life in Surrey, BC: What a Perfect Day Looks Like

Explore a day in Surrey, BC — from morning walks to evening markets. Discover why this lifestyle gem blends nature, culture, and community so perfectly. Wake Up to Surrey’s Natural Charm Imagine waking up to the sound of birds chirping outside your window. In Surrey, that’s not a rare treat — it’s the norm. With […]

Surrey's park

Explore a day in Surrey, BC — from morning walks to evening markets. Discover why this lifestyle gem blends nature, culture, and community so perfectly.

Wake Up to Surrey’s Natural Charm

Imagine waking up to the sound of birds chirping outside your window. In Surrey, that’s not a rare treat — it’s the norm. With leafy neighborhoods, wide green spaces, and trails that start just steps from your door, mornings here feel like a breath of fresh air. Many locals kick off the day with a stroll through Bear Creek Park or a jog at Tynehead Regional Park. It’s the kind of peaceful start that sets the tone for the whole day.

Mid-Morning Coffee, the Local Way

By mid-morning, it’s time for caffeine. And Surrey knows how to deliver. Whether you’re into trendy espresso bars or cozy neighborhood cafés, there’s always a perfect cup waiting. Locals often gather at spots like Cafe Central or Everbean for a latte and light conversation. It’s not just about coffee — it’s community in a cup.

Lunchtime in a Multicultural Food Haven

When lunch rolls around, you’re spoiled for choice. Surrey is known for its incredible diversity, and that shows in its food. Craving Indian street food? There’s a spot for that. Sushi? Absolutely. Korean BBQ? Done. Whether it’s a food truck at Holland Park or a sit-down meal in Newton, the city’s culinary offerings are as diverse as its people.

Afternoons That Blend Culture and Calm

After lunch, many locals find time to relax or explore. The Surrey Art Gallery often hosts engaging exhibits, while Historic Stewart Farm gives a glimpse into the area’s pioneer past. If you’re just looking to unwind, a quiet read in Crescent Park or a family bike ride through Green Timbers is always a good idea.

Evenings Are for Connection and Celebration

As the sun sets, Surrey comes alive in a different way. Food markets pop up, especially in summer, and community events often fill the calendar. Whether it’s outdoor concerts, cultural festivals, or just a walk along the Crescent Beach promenade, there’s a buzz in the air. Families, friends, and even strangers come together — that’s just how Surrey works.

Why Surrey Isn’t Just a Place — It’s a Lifestyle

What makes a city more than just a spot on the map? In Surrey, it’s the way life flows so naturally between city buzz and serene beauty. It’s the way cultures mix, not just side by side, but together. It’s how a regular Wednesday feels like a weekend. From sunrise to sunset, living in Surrey means more than just living well — it means living fully.
